๐Ÿ’ก Step-by-step: Find Tunisia Twitter creators (practical)

1) Start with Twitter-native search sets - Use Twitter advanced search for keywords in French and Tunisian Arabic (e.g., “mode Tunis”, “tenue tunisienne”, “look Tunis”). Filter by “Latest” to find active voices. - Scan for repeat engagement: creators who spark threads or get replies, not just vanity likes.

2) Use platform intelligence & local lists - Leftyโ€™s trend work shows TikTok drives earned runway value, but use similar intelligence on Twitter by checking third-party tools or local aggregator accounts that curate Tunisian creators. - Build X (Twitter) lists: make a private list of candidates and monitor a 7-day activity window โ€” conversation quality is more important than follower size.

3) Map cross-platform presence - Many Tunisian creators cross-post to TikTok or Instagram. Check bios for links and validate assets. Creators who do short-form video + Twitter commentary are gold for clothing drops (visuals + linkable CTAs).

4) Outreach that works (template) - DM or email short, personal, and benefits-first. Example: “Hi [Name], love your recent thread on [topic]. Weโ€™re launching a limited capsule for global customers and think your styling voice fits. Interested in a paid collab with product + $[fee] for 1 tweet + 1 video? Happy to share specs.”

5) Local rates & payments - Micro-influencers: $70โ€“$250 per tweet/package (table above). - Offer product + small fee for first tests; after 2โ€“3 successful posts, scale with performance bonuses tied to codes or tracked links.

6) Legal, language, and measurement - Contracts: clear deliverables, posting windows, usage rights, and translation responsibilities. Ask for native analytics screenshots after posting. - Use UTM-coded links and short codes to track conversions per creator.

๐Ÿ” Screening checklist (hard filters)

  • Recent activity in last 14 days.
  • Organic replies or conversation (not spammy comments).
  • Clear cross-platform links and contact info.
  • Willing to share native analytics.
  • Audience matches your target age/gender/style.

๐Ÿ’ก Campaign formats that convert in Tunisia

  • Twitter Thread Launch: creator posts a styled thread with images, link to shop, and a limited-code โ€” great for FOMO.
  • Twitter + TikTok Duo: one creator posts a visual TikTok lookbook, then a follow-up Twitter thread for context and link.
  • Micro-tweet storms: multiple micro-creators post on release day to dominate conversation and replies.
  • Localized UGC packages: creators produce 1 vertical video (TikTok/IG Reels), 2 tweet promos, and a candid styling thread.

๐Ÿ™‹ Frequently Asked Questions

โ“ How many creators should I test first?

๐Ÿ’ฌ Start with 5โ€“10 micro creators โ€” run a week-long test with product + small fee. Scale winners into larger bundles or long-term ambassadorships.

๐Ÿ› ๏ธ What tracking tech is non-negotiable?

๐Ÿ’ฌ UTM links, unique promo codes per creator, and a dashboard (even a Google Sheet) pulling conversions from your eโ€‘commerce platform. Ask creators for native analytics screenshots after each post.

๐Ÿง  Can I rely on agencies to find Tunisia creators?

๐Ÿ’ฌ Yes, but vet their local footprint. Global agencies may miss micro-community nuance. A hybrid approach (agency + direct outreach) usually wins.
